Andy's Sprinkler, Drainage & Lighting is a trusted name in the home services industry, specializing in irrigation system repairs, landscape drainage solutions, and low-voltage landscape lighting.Founded in 1987 by Andy Hulcy in Carrollton, Texas, the company has built a reputation for delivering high-quality, reliable services to homeowners and businesses alike.With a commitment to customer satisfaction and a focus on innovation, Andy's has expanded its footprint across Texas, South Carolina, and Florida, offering franchise opportunities to entrepreneurs seeking to invest in a proven business model.

Andy's Sprinkler, Drainage & Lighting offers a robust support and training program for its franchisees:
Pre-Launch Training: Franchisees undergo 2–4 weeks of training at the corporate headquarters in Carrollton, Texas, approximately six weeks before the scheduled opening.
On-Site Training: One week of training at the franchise location to ensure smooth operations from day one.
Ongoing Support: Two refresher/update training sessions per year, each lasting up to two days, to keep franchisees informed about the latest industry trends and company practices.
Operational Assistance: Guidance in site selection, territory definition, and business setup to ensure optimal location and market reach.
Marketing Support: Access to marketing materials and strategies to promote the business effectively within the designated territory.
Technical Training: Continuous education on the latest techniques and products in irrigation, drainage, and lighting services.

Financial Component | Details / Range |
---|---|
Franchise Fee | $30,000 |
Total Initial Investment | $70,000 – $162,000 (Average ~$117,000) |
Minimum Cash Required | $106,900 |
Royalty Fees | Percentage of gross sales (specific % not publicly disclosed) |
Marketing / Advertising Fees | Local marketing contributions expected (specific % varies by location) |
Break-Even Time | Typically 12 – 24 months, depending on market and location |
Revenue Streams | Sprinkler installation & repair, drainage solutions, landscape lighting, product sales |
